hemostasis

/hɛməˈsteɪsɪs/ noun · British & US
Valid in UKValid in US
Share WhatsApp

What does hemostasis mean?

noun

The process or state of stopping bleeding or blood loss, either naturally or through medical intervention.

Example

"The surgeon's skill in achieving hemostasis was crucial in saving the patient's life."
